
Lucid has revealed its production and delivery figures for the first quarter ended March 31, 2024. The company announced it produced 1,728 vehicles and achieved deliveries of 1,967 vehicles during the quarter.
This deliveries number beats Wall Street estimates and is far lower than the 2021 SPAC presentation where it said it was forecasted to be delivering 90,000 EVs annually in 2024. The company missed its revenue targets by 90% in 2023.
Compared to the year-ago quarter, this is an increase of 40%, up from 1,406 cars delivered.
The company will hold its Q1 earnings call on Monday, May 6, 2024, at 2:30 pm PT / 5:30 pm ET. The company plans to release an earnings press release prior to the call, which will include a link to the live webcast available on its investor relations website.
These numbers are good for Lucid but the company still remains unprofitable, while it only has its Lucid Air sedan available for customers. Let’s wait to see what its Q1 2024 earnings will be when they are announced next month.
